NASA principals during a church service at Friends Church Ngong Road, Sunday July 23, 2017. [Photo: Philip Etale]The National Super Alliance (Nasa), now claims unknown persons are after the life of presidential candidate Raila Odinga.Nasa co-principal Moses Wetangula, said some cars have been trailing the former prime minister, on several occasions, with aims to find out his moves, for unknown reasons, but possibly to eliminate him."Some vehicles whose number plates we have in possession, have been trailing Odinga," said Wetangula, Sunday.Speaking at Orange House, during a Nasa press conference, alongside Odinga, Kalonzo Musyoka, and Musalia Mudavadi, Wetangula indicated that the government was aware of this, since the police was informed, and was asked to provide more security for Odinga.In a joint statement, Nasa asked the government to chip in, and help unravel the mystery of those vehicles trailing Odinga, to assure supporters and Kenyans at large that Raila's life, was not in danger.

They further reiterated claims that the Jubilee administration was planning to use the military and the police to harass Nasa voters in areas where the alliance enjoys massive following.They addressed the press after attending a church service at Friends Church Ngong Road, ahead of the Nairobi County campaign rally.
